摘要
The correlations of the linear and circular polarizations in the system of two photons have been theoretically investigated. The polarization of a two-photon state is described by the one-photon Stokes parameters and by the components of the correlation "tensor" in the Stokes space. It is shown that in the case of two-photon decays pi(0) -> 2 gamma, eta -> 2 gamma, K-L(0) -> 2 gamma, K-S(0) -> 2 gamma and the cascade process vertical bar 0 > -> vertical bar 1 > + gamma -> vertical bar 0 > + 2 theta (vertical bar 0 > and vertical bar 1 > are states with the spin 0 and 1, respectively) the final two-photon state represents a characteristic example of the entangled (nonfactorizable) state, and the correlations between the Stokes parameters in all these decays have the purely quantum character: the incoherence inequalities of the Bell type for the components of the correlation "tensor", established previously for the case of classical "mixtures", are violated. The general analysis of the registration procedure for two correlated photons by two one-photon detectors is performed.
